Mr Ijaz Sheikh is a Consultant Ophthalmologist at Ashtead Hospital in Surrey
Mr Sheikh's special clinical interests include the diagnosis and management of macular degeneration, diabetic retinopathy, retinal vein occlusions, complex uveitis cases, cataract and eyelid surgery.
Mr Sheikh has performed treatments such as intravitreal injection therapy, laser treatment for diabetic eye diseases and treated other retinal problems.
His recent interests are to develop quality audits, publications, research projects and artificial intelligence-based diabetic retinopathy screening in his native country.

Mr Sheikh has several international publications and presentations and is actively involved in the teaching and training of other ophthalmologists, optometrists and nurses. He is also an examiner for the Royal College of Ophthalmologists and Royal College of Physicians & Surgeons of Glasgow
